Why Talking to a Brick Wall Feels Impossible

Trying to communicate with resistance isn’t just exhausting—it’s mentally draining. Psychologically, brick wall situations often stem from:

  • Misaligned expectations
  • Emotional barriers or defensiveness
  • Lack of psychological safety
  • Poor timing or phrasing
  • Deep-rooted beliefs blocking dialogue

Mind-Blowing Strategies to Break Through

1. Shift from Speak to Listen—Truly Listen

Silence isn’t emptiness—it’s information. Instead of pushing your point, practice active listening. When the other person feels fully heard, their walls relax instantly. Use reflective listening: echo emotions (“It sounds like you’re frustrated”), and ask open-ended questions. Suddenly, the wall crumbles.

2. Use “Identification” to Build Rapport

People resist voices they don’t recognize. Mirror their tone, pace, and key phrases subtly. This builds subconscious trust and opens pathways for meaningful exchange. Think of it as emotional priming—your credibility quietly rises.

3. Frame Messages as Invitations, Not Demands

Statements like “You need to change” act like declarations of fate. Reframe with curiosity: “Would it be helpful to explore why things feel stuck this way?” Invitations lower defenses and spark collaboration.

4. Apply the “Pause & Probe” Technique

When words stall, pause. Don’t rush. Use silence to amplify impact. Then probe deeper with questions like, “What’s really behind this resistance?” Silence forces reflection—and opens doors to hidden truths.

5. Rewire the Narrative with “What-If Scenarios”

Transform conflict into possibility by asking: “What if things worked safely this way?” This subtle shift moves conversation beyond blame to collaborative problem-solving.
